Mellisa's POV 

None other than Diana, my ex best friend, makes an appearance.

She is yet to look at me as she is fixing her revealing top and tiny skirt.

“Why are you here, Diana?” Adam asks with gritted teeth.

She lifts her head up to reply but her eyes freeze at the sight of me.

“Who is this again?” Fred asks through the mindlink.

“My ex best friend I told you guys about.” I reply, making sure he and Aiden hear me through the mindlink. 

“What is SHE doing here?” She sneers in contempt.

Angry growls resound in my office, “Watch your dog, Alpha Adam.” Aiden says too calmly.

“How dare you? I'm a Beta's daughter and the future Luna of the Red Crescent.”

A chuckle escapes my lips, if only she knew. 

“Funny, how you referred to me as a two-timer but you couldn't wait to get rid of me and cling to her.” I say as I walk round my table standing between Fred and Aiden. 

“Wait, who are you in this pack? Why is there a low-life like you in the Alpha's office?” Diana asks in confusion and contempt. 

“Leave it be, Diana. Let's go.” Adam walks towards her and holds onto her arms. 

She yanks her arms off him. “No, I'm pretty sure the Alpha doesn't know you were banished for infidelity and betrayal.”

Fred steps forward, but I hold him back. His action wipes the smirk off her face.

Adam takes a deep breath and mutters, “I apologise for her foolish words, Alpha. It won't happen again, I'll make sure of it.”

Her eyes bulged out in shock, “W..what!!!” She stutters.

I take strong strides towards them towards the door, Aiden and Fred in tow.

I push my wolf, Selena, forward partially shifting, perks of being a white wolf. 

I stop right in front of her “If you ever disrespect me again, I'll leave you crawling and begging me to stop, I'm no longer that naive little girl you used to know.” I say flashing my canines.

“Now get out,” I point towards the door. 

Adam gives her a deathly stare and drags her by the arm, walking out.

“What do you mean by Alpha, who is Alpha?” Diana whispers down the hallway in fear.

After a few seconds, the three of us burst into a fit of laughter. 

I catch my breath after a while, “I don't know how I once saw her as my sister.” 

“She looks like someone begging for attention.” Fred says, rolling his eyes.

“You know at some point I didn't feel comfortable with her getting too touchy with Adam. Worse, she was always asking about how he was.”

“You think they were together before you left?”

“Probably, nothing surprises me anymore.” 

“But guys come to think of it, it seems they are yet to mate.” Aiden adds thoughtfully. 

“What do you mean?”

He sighs, “My problem with you two is that you never pay attention and listen.”

“Whatever, go straight to the point, stupid.”

“In her little rant she said that she is the future Luna,” Aiden says.

“What! That's so unusual. Alphas bond with their mates almost immediately, even chosen mates as herself.” Fred replies in deep thought.

“There might be a bit of trouble in paradise.” Aiden says. 

“Well, that's their problem as long as they stay the hell away from me.” I say going back to my paperwork.

“What about Gift?” Aiden breaks the tight silence.

“What about my son?” I ask defensively. 

“What would you do if he gets to know that he's his father?” Aiden doesn't back down.

I love and hate that about him right now. 

“He isn't his father. You two are much closer to that name than he is.”

He lets out a breath in exasperation, “He will figure this all out. Even if it's not right now, sooner or later it will all come to light.”

Anger surged through my veins. “And you think I don't know that? What would you have me do? Walk up to him and hand my child over?”

Aiden's eyes widen at my outburst but I don't care the least right now. 

“No, I just…..”

“This guy we're talking about threw me out like I meant nothing, barely acknowledged me when we were together.” I interrupt.

“Do you not see that he might do the same to my pup?”

Selena whimpers at the back of my mind. 

I try to reign over the rage but it is not working. Both of them stare at me in shock but keep silent.

“I'm out, don't wait for me at lunch.” I stalk out of the office, deep in thought. Soon I was out of the pack house. The clearing in front is empty, but a few pack members, everyone is carrying out their duties. 

I need to shift, so I can cool off. My paws soon hit the bare floor, the hot sun rays hit my back as I push past the trees in a blur.

“Let's go to our favourite place,” Selena mutters at the back of my mind.

I hum in agreement and take a sharp turn to the waterfall, I slow down to a trot as I approach my destination. 

“Let's take a rest here,” She says. I settle by the waterfall birds chirping above me.

“I'm sorry, I wasn't there for you when you needed me the most.” She continues. 

“Selena, stop. You did nothing wrong, we all went through pain and I might have even lost my life if you had shown up earlier.”

“You know I can feel the intense pain of what you wish you always had,” She answers. 

I take in a gasp of surprise. “I know you have been trying to take it all upon yourself. But we are one, I feel it and I wish I could take it away.” 

“I always just wanted love, or is that too much to ask? Don't I deserve love?” I ask

“You deserve love, Mel. You mean so much more than you think. Look around you, you're loved. Your parents, Gift, Fred, Aiden and the pack members love you.”

Realization dawned on me. I have been rather selfish in my thoughts.

“I've been so blinded by my pain that I have closed my heart off from everyone, I've been pretending to be okay. But, my heart is so injured.”

“We're in this together, Mel. I won't let you be alone. We will heal together, okay?”

“Okay.” Feeling a lot lighter, the heaviness I felt earlier lessened. I know I'm not completely healed but I'll take the first steps needed.

“You know Aiden meant no harm right? He cares about you and just wanted you to brace yourself in case Adam found out about Gift.”

I take a deep breath, “I guess I overreacted a little bit.”

She scoffs with sarcasm. “Yeah right.”

“Someone's coming, shift, and get dressed.” I walk to a large tree trunk, one of the places in the forest where my pack keeps clothes for pack members that want to shift.

Just as I slip on the large shirt and shorts, I get a whiff of my friends. 

They still care even after my outburst.

 “It's time for lunch and we couldn't have it without you,” Fred stepped forward from the trees.

I spin so fast around, I need to apologise at least it's a start.

“I know you guys can't do without me,” a smile playing on my lips.

I stalk forward towards them and walk right past Fred to Aiden who was looking a bit guilty.

“I'm sorry!!!” We speak at once.

“You go first,” he says in relief. 

“I'm sorry I lashed out at you, you're right I need to brace myself for it when he finds out.”

He then shakes his head, “No, I'm sorry for being insensitive. What you need right now is love and support and not me being all rational.”

“But it came from a place of love. Yes, I'm so scared and overwhelmed but I shouldn't be blind to the fact that you guys care and love me with all your hearts.”

“Your fears are valid, though.”

“Can you guys hug it out already?” Fred teases with a bratty voice.

“Sure,” I answer with mischief since Aiden hates mushy stuff.

“No, get away from me.” He was heading towards the clearing, I jumped on his back.

“You little flea,” he spins me over, drops me on the ground, going for my sides and tickling me silly.

“Let goooo!!!” Peals of laughter burst out from my mouth, Fred then joins in.

“What the hell is going on here?” A raging voice causes us to freeze.
